I wanted to share 2 free places for kids and families to play in Carrollton, Texas.  Carrollton is just north of Dallas and a quick trip from many north Dallas locations.  There are 2 fun places here that I feel are worth the drive.

W.J. Thomas Splash Park
1955 N. Perry Road Carrollton, TX 75006

This splash park is awesome!  There are plenty of fun water features that it can accommodate a large number of people comfortably.  This location is open from 9am-8pm, so it’s available for use during less common times, making it easy to beat the crowds if wanted.
We have shown up at various times and have never felt that it was too busy to stay.  There are TONS of picnic tables, almost all of them covered, and it is adjacent to a small playground as well.  They are currently building bathrooms and they should be open soon.  So far this summer, each time we have gone, some independent ice cream man (or men!  sometimes more than one!) has been around, so bring some cash if you think you might want a snack… or better yet, pack your own!  We have enjoyed many picnic lunches out there!  There are grills available and plenty of trashcans.
Don’t forget your towel and some sunscreen!
Indoor Play Area @ Covenant Church Carrollton

2660 E. Trinity Mills Rd Carrollton, TX 75006 (Located in The Life Center building)

Soft play area for your littlest explorer

This play area is SO much fun for kids!  It’s a hidden gym in Carrollton and it just opened Easter weekend 2012.  To get there, park in front of The Life Center (the side facing Trinity Mills) and enter in those doors.  Once inside, go to the left through The Cafe toward the back and through the big double doors.  (You can always ask someone if you’re not sure where to go!)
Once inside, there is a restroom available, a few picnic tables, and tons of fun for the kids!

Right next to that is this huge play area for bigger kids!  There’s a basketball court in there for littles, too!
There are even action-activated video games the kids can interact with, as well as a basketball court, the huge play structure, soft play area for little kids, and some little play stations where the kids can strap on hard hats to be a construction worker or aprons to be a great chef!  There’s even a Lego table.
Plenty of opportunities for imaginative play, as well.

I believe this play area is open whenever The Life Center building is open and OF COURSE children must be supervised in order to play. You can even support their cafe while you are there and purchase a coffee, pastry, sandwich, or fruit while you hang out with the kiddos. You can also bring your own food and snacks as well, but please clean up after yourself!
